Sandra Hallvey
LP (Item 588484) JSB (France), 1981 — Condition: Near Mint-
African grooves meet European club – in a totally sweet session with a very unique feel! Sandra Hallvey sings in French, sometimes with a breathy Euro style – but arrangements are by Jo Tongo, and have lots of funky undercurrents – offbeat grooves that electrify some deeper African funk elements, blended perfectly with some hip Parisian production! Titles include 'Hollywood Star", "Et Je Brule Ma Vie", "Fulla Girl", "Salsa Dance", and "Couleur Vanille". © 1996-2013, Dusty Groove, Inc. | ||||||
